2. Ghilotti

Google Reviews:

Company Description

For over a century, this company has provided underground utility construction services across different towns in California. Ghilotti crew has experience in site preparation and all utility installation and repairs. Apart from that, the contractor has an emergency response team to help you attend to hazardous leaks or breaks. Ghilotti can also help with soil stabilization through moisture conditioning, lime, and cement treatments.

4. Bay Area Trenchless

Google Reviews:

Company Description

As the name suggests, this contractor focuses on trenchless underground utility services. The technique comes in handy for preserving your landscape and ensuring minimal environmental disturbances. Bay Area Trenchless has water, sceptic, sewer, and gas line installation specialists. They can also repair or replace faulty, leaky, or malfunctioning water heaters and drainage systems.

5. Underground Construction Co

Google Reviews:

Company description

Underground Construction Co. stands out when it comes to gas, power, airport fueling and telecom distribution. The underground utility construction company has served California for over 80 years. The diverse team in the company guarantees efficient handling of commercial, residential, industrial, and public construction projects across the state.
